Hilly Ridge Alpacas

Location : Clay Hill Farm, Clay Hill Lane, Wattisham Suffolk. IP7 7JS

On an alpaca experience at Hilly Ridge you will leave knowing a lot more about alpaca than when you came and hopefully you will be captivated and will leave with a huge smile on your face.

They pack a lot into your time, you will go for a lovely relaxing walk with the alpacas , then off into the field with the mums and young babies.

Then it’s time to take up the challenge of the Hilly Ridge Obstacle course with a wonderful 1st place rosette up for grabs!

The experience lasts for 90 minutes however please allow two hours as we don’t want to rush!

Unicorn Alpaca Walks

Location : Wilderley, Church Farm, The Hill, Shipmeadow, Beccles, Suffolk NR34 8HJ

The walk takes you on the alpaca trail, past a little runway and on to a circular walk around the top fields. It lasts approximately 45 minutes to an hour depending on the size of group and how frequently your alpaca stops for a grassy snack.

Afterwards you’ll be offered some refreshments and a short tour of the farm – meeting all the other animals from the Polish chickens with their shaggy topknots to Bear, the fabulous Skunk to the cheeky team of Pygmy goats, guinea pig family, and much much more. Hang a wish on the famous wishing tree & enjoy all the fun of the farm.
